软件工程到底是什么?让我们一同来探讨一下这个在科技领域的重要概念。


软件工程是一个重要的领域,它涉及到创建、设计、开发、测试和维护软件系统的各个方面。随着科技的飞速发展,软件已经成为现代社会不可或缺的一部分,几乎所有行业都依赖于高效、可靠的软件来提升生产力和服务质量。因此,深入探讨软件工程的定义及其重要性,对于理解当今科技环境至关重要。

软件工程到底是什么?让我们一同来探讨一下这个在科技领域的重要概念。

首先,软件工程不仅仅是编写代码,它是一个系统化的过程。软件工程师需要运用多种技术和方法论,从需求分析到系统设计,再到编码、测试和维护,整个过程都需要遵循特定的原则和标准。通过这种系统化的开发方式,软件工程能够有效地减少软件项目中的风险,提高开发效率,并确保最终产品的质量。软件工程师还需要与项目管理人员、客户和其他相关人员进行沟通,以确保软件能够满足用户的需求和期望。

其次,软件工程强调团队合作与跨学科协作。现代软件开发通常不是一个单独的个体所能完成的任务,而是需要一个专业团队共同努力。团队成员可能来自不同的领域,包括需求分析、设计、开发、测试和运维等。这样的多学科协作可以帮助团队在不同环节之间建立更好的理解,从而提高项目的成功率。此外,敏捷开发等现代软件工程方法论的推广,也使得团队合作更加高效和灵活。

在软件工程中,质量保障是一个至关重要的环节。软件的发布并不意味着它的生命周期结束,实际上,后期的维护和更新同样重要。因此,测试与验证成为软件工程中的重要组成部分。通过测试,开发团队能够识别并修复潜在的问题,从而提升软件的可靠性与安全性。持续集成和持续交付等实践,进一步促进了软件的质量管理,使得软件在快速迭代的同时,依然保持高标准的质量控制。

最后,软件工程的未来充满了机遇与挑战。随着人工智能、云计算、大数据等新兴技术的不断涌现,软件工程师将面临新的技能需求和职业发展方向。如何在快速变化的科技环境中保持竞争力,成为了每位软件工程师需要思考的问题。同时,随着软件应用的普及,软件安全和隐私保护也日益重要,软件工程师需要更加关注这些方面,以确保用户信息的安全性和软件的可信性。

综上所述,软件工程不仅是技术开发的过程,更是一个涉及团队合作、质量管理、用户需求等多个方面的综合性学科。了解软件工程的本质和重要性,能够帮助我们更好地应对未来的科技挑战。无论是作为从业者,还是作为普通用户,关注软件工程都将为我们的生活和工作带来积极的影响。

<< 上一篇

女性私密紧致治疗方案,水多问题有效改善的最新方法

下一篇 >>

万亿女王归来,再度引领财富潮流的传奇时刻

版权声明

除非注明,文章均由 容大互联 整理发布,欢迎转载。

转载请注明本文地址:http://m.0594179.com/wenda/25920.shtml

相关文章